Pressureless sintered silicon carbide (SiC) thermocouple protection tubes are high-performance ceramic tubes fabricated from high-purity SiC using a pressureless sintering process. Their key advantages include high strength, exceptional high-temperature resistance, superior corrosion resistance, and excellent thermal shock resistance, making them ideal for temperature measurement in extreme industrial environments. They provide long-term, stable protection for thermocouples against physical and chemical degradation.
Physical properties | Unit | SSiC | |
Composition:SiC | Vol% | ≥98 | |
Density 20 ℃ | g/cm3 | ≥3.06 | |
Open Porosity | Vol% | ≈0 | |
Hardness | Rockwell Hardness 45N | R45N | 93 |
Vickers Hardness HV1 | kg/mm2 | 2350 | |
Flexural Strength | 20°C | MPa | 320-400 |
1300°C | MPa | 300-400 | |
Coficient of Thermal Expansion | 10-6K-1 | 4.0 | |
hermal Conductivity | 20°C | Wm-1K-1 | 196 |
1200°C | Wm-1K-1 | 60 | |
Modulus of Elasticity @ RT | GPa | 410 | |
Thermal shock resistance | ℃ | >350 | |
Max. Service Temp (air) | ℃ | 1650 |
Maximum operating temperature: 1,650°C.
Maximum length: 3 meters.
Maximum outer diameter: 190 mm.
